First published: Wed Mar 06 2024(Updated: )
A c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Customer Support System v1 allows attackers to execute arbitrary web scripts or HTML via a crafted payload injected into the email parameter at /customer_support/index.php?page=customer_list.

CVE-2023-49973 is classified as a medium severity vulnerability due to its potential for cross-site scripting exploits.
To fix CVE-2023-49973, validate and sanitize user inputs, especially the email parameter in the /customer_support/index.php endpoint.
CVE-2023-49973 affects users of Customer Support System version 1.0.
CVE-2023-49973 is a c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ability.
Yes, CVE-2023-49973 can lead to data theft and unauthorized actions by allowing attackers to execute arbitrary scripts.
